Starting With User Research
User research is an important part of creating effective digital experiences. Before designing a product, businesses need to understand who their users are and what they expect.
Research methods can include interviews, surveys, competitor analysis, analytics, user observations, and usability studies. These activities provide insights into user goals, preferences, and pain points.

Designing User Flows
User flows show the steps users take to complete specific tasks within a digital product.
For example, a customer may need to search for a product, add it to a cart, complete payment, and receive confirmation. Each step should be clear and easy to understand.
Designers analyze these flows to remove unnecessary steps and reduce friction. Simplifying user journeys can improve usability and create a more efficient experience.
Wireframing and Prototyping
Wireframes provide an early representation of a product's structure. They help teams understand layouts, navigation, and content placement before visual details are finalized.
Prototypes provide a more interactive representation of the product. Stakeholders and users can interact with prototypes and provide feedback before development begins.

Usability Testing
Usability testing allows businesses to evaluate how real users interact with a product.
During testing, users may be asked to complete specific tasks while design teams observe their behavior. This process can reveal navigation problems, confusing content, and difficult interactions.
The feedback can then be used to improve the product before and after launch.
Continuous usability testing helps ensure that digital experiences remain aligned with user expectations.
Accessibility and Inclusive Experiences
Digital products should be designed to support users with different abilities and needs. Accessibility should be considered throughout the design process.
Designers can focus on clear content, readable typography, sufficient color contrast, keyboard navigation, and accessible interaction patterns.
